  • How does KAYAK's flight Price Forecast tool help me choose the right time to buy my flight ticket from Lexington to Virginia?

    KAYAK’s flight Price Forecast tool uses historical data to determine whether the price for a flight from Lexington to Virginia is likely to change within 7 days, so travelers know whether to wait or book now.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Lexington to Virginia?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ly from Lexington to Virginia with an airline and back with another airline.

  • What is KAYAK's "flexible dates" feature and why should I care when looking for a flight from Lexington to Virginia?

    Sometimes travel dates aren't set in stone. If your preferred travel dates have some wiggle room, flexible dates will show you all the options when flying from Lexington to Virginia up to 3 days before/after your preferred dates. You can then pick the flights that suit you best.
